I'm glad that you are liking these, Tim. I'm sure having fun taking them. I'm using a Nikkor 80-400 mm VR zoom lens on my D300. I'm also using a tripod, but I'm moving it around so much that it's kind of like a massive monopod. The birds are attracted to black sunflower seeds in a feeder in my backyard. If I just sit quietly they'll let me get to within about 10-15 feet, sometimes closer. I was going to set up my deer blind, but that would have limited my ability to move around.
